Welcome to our special Thanksgiving Day edition of NFL SlateIQ. For those of you unfamiliar with SlateIQ, it is a product here at RotoGrinders where we use our very own ResultsDB to find the most similar historical slates to the current week, and we take a look at how the top lineups are constructing their rosters compared to the field based on several key metrics. You can look at the main slate Week 11 version of SlateIQ here, or you can take a peek at the latest Showdown version of NFL SlateIQ here.

The Thanksgiving Day NFL slate is one of most DFSers’ favorite of the year, and it is extremely unique, so we wanted to put together a special version of SlateIQ that focuses on just these types of 3-game slates to see if we could learn anything that could gain us some leverage on the field. So, instead of our normal SlateIQ process, here we’ll take a look back at DraftKings tournaments from the 3-game slates over the last couple years to see what we could learn about roster construction, stacking and ownership from the top lineups compared to the field in this very different NFL slate.
